izzymo asked:
I gave my 2 year old crayons that I thought would wipe off of the bath tub (they are the crayons that come with a dry erase activity mat), and now nothing will take it off. I’ve tried foaming bathtub cleaner, bleach, 409, sos pads, WD-40 and even an organic carpet cleaner (I was desperate). Does anyone know of a magic formula for getting something like that off? The tub we have must be extremely porous because it’s as if I let her draw with permanent marker. Any suggestions would be appreciated. Thanks!

If it isn’t a plastic or a meltable surface you can try an iron, no steam, and a brown paper bag. You put the brown paper bag over the crayon and apply the iron for a couple of seconds at a time. Rotate the paper bag so you are re-Applying the crayon you are melting off. This also work with candle wax and carpet

Bar Keeper’s Friend will get it off. It is sort of like comet only much better. It comes in a gold container like comet. Make a nice paste and let it sit on the spot for a little bit. then get a scrubber and scrub it away. That stuff cleans everything.
